What Does General Plumbing Maintenance Include?

General plumbing maintenance includes inspecting fixtures, testing water pressure, checking for leaks, and flushing water heaters to prevent future problems.

Technicians examine faucets, toilets, and exposed pipes for signs of wear or corrosion. They test water pressure at multiple points to identify restrictions or supply issues.

Drain lines are checked for slow flow that signals developing clogs. Water heaters are flushed to remove sediment that reduces efficiency and shortens lifespan. Regular maintenance catches small issues before they become expensive emergencies, extending the life of your plumbing system and reducing repair costs over time.

How Often Should You Schedule Plumbing Inspections?

Schedule plumbing inspections annually for most homes, or more frequently for older properties with outdated systems or recurring issues.

Annual inspections allow a plumber to spot early signs of corrosion, leaks, or component wear before they cause damage. Homes over 30 years old or those with galvanized steel or polybutylene piping benefit from more frequent checks.

Commercial properties with high usage should schedule inspections every six months to maintain reliability and avoid business disruptions. Seasonal inspections before winter help identify vulnerable outdoor faucets and pipes that need protection from freezing temperatures. Consistent inspections save money by preventing major failures and water damage.

Do Plumbing Repairs Require Permits?

Plumbing repairs that involve new installations, rerouting pipes, or modifying fixtures typically require permits to ensure code compliance and safety.

Simple repairs like fixing a leaky faucet or replacing a toilet usually do not need permits. However, adding new fixtures, extending supply lines, or replacing sewer connections often require permits and inspections from local building authorities.

Licensed plumbers handle permit applications and ensure work meets current codes. Unpermitted work can complicate home sales, void insurance coverage, and create liability issues if problems arise later. Always verify permit requirements with your plumber before starting major projects.

What Plumbing Issues Are Common in Older Homes?

Common plumbing issues in older homes include corroded pipes, outdated fixtures, low water pressure, and inadequate drainage from undersized lines.

Galvanized steel pipes installed before the 1960s rust internally and restrict water flow over time. Cast iron drain lines crack and develop leaks as they age, leading to slow drainage and sewage odors.

Older fixtures lack modern water-saving features and may have worn washers or seals that cause leaks. Homes built before current plumbing codes may have undersized supply lines that cannot meet today's water demand. Upgrading pipes and fixtures improves performance and prevents ongoing repair costs.

Can General Plumbing Services Handle Commercial Properties?

General plumbing services can handle commercial properties by providing repairs, installations, and maintenance for larger systems with higher demands than residential plumbing.

Commercial plumbing involves more fixtures, higher water volume, and complex drainage systems that serve multiple floors or units. Plumbers working on commercial properties understand code requirements for backflow prevention, grease traps, and accessibility standards.

They coordinate with building managers to minimize disruptions during business hours and respond quickly to emergencies that could halt operations. Regular maintenance contracts help commercial properties avoid costly downtime and ensure compliance with health and safety regulations.
